Understanding Iovance's Approach: TIL Therapy
Alright, let's get into the nitty-gritty of what Iovance Biotherapeutics does. They're all about TIL therapy, a type of cancer immunotherapy. But what exactly does that mean? Well, guys, TIL therapy works by using your own immune cells to fight cancer. Your immune system is like your body's personal army, constantly on the lookout for threats like infections and, yes, cancer cells. The cool part is, within a tumor, there are immune cells called tumor-infiltrating lymphocytes (TILs) that have already recognized the cancer cells. These TILs are essentially your body's first line of defense, already doing the work to spot and potentially fight the cancer. The problem is that tumors are sneaky and often create an environment that suppresses the immune system, preventing TILs from effectively destroying the cancer cells. Iovance's approach is to extract these TILs from a patient's tumor, grow them in the lab (a process called ex vivo expansion), and then infuse them back into the patient. But before reintroducing the TILs, the patient typically undergoes lymphodepletion – a process that essentially clears out some of their existing immune cells. This creates space and helps the TILs take hold and do their job more effectively. So, they harvest your own immune cells, multiply them like crazy in a lab, and then give them a boost to fight the cancer. This process can involve several steps, including surgical resection of the tumor, laboratory processing, patient preconditioning, and the infusion of the TIL product. The whole idea is to provide the patient with a large number of TILs with enhanced anti-tumor activity. It is important to emphasize that TIL therapy is highly personalized, as it uses a patient's own immune cells to fight their cancer. Iovance's Pipeline: Key Product Candidates
Okay, let's move on to the good stuff: Iovance's pipeline and the product candidates they're working on. They've got a few key players in the game, all focusing on different types of cancer. Their lead product candidate, lifileucel, is the most advanced in clinical development. Lifileucel is an autologous TIL therapy, meaning it is derived from the patient's own tumor tissue. It has shown promising results in treating melanoma, a type of skin cancer. The company has conducted several clinical trials for lifileucel, which have provided valuable data on its safety and efficacy. The initial clinical trials have shown encouraging results, with some patients experiencing significant tumor shrinkage and prolonged responses. The Clinical Trial Journey: Trials and Tribulations
So, how does Iovance get its therapies from the lab to patients? Through clinical trials, of course! Clinical trials are a critical part of the drug development process. They are a series of research studies designed to evaluate the safety and effectiveness of new medical treatments. It's a long and challenging road, but essential for ensuring that new therapies are safe and effective before they're available to the general public. Iovance's product candidates have gone through different phases of clinical trials to assess their efficacy and safety. This is how they prove that their treatments actually work. These trials are conducted in phases, each designed to answer specific questions about the therapy. The primary goal is to determine if a new treatment is effective and if the benefits outweigh the risks. Phase 1 trials focus on safety, Phase 2 explores efficacy and optimal dosing, and Phase 3 is a large-scale trial to confirm results and get regulatory approval. They start with Phase 1 trials, which are all about safety. Then come Phase 2 trials, where they start to look at how well the therapy works. And finally, Phase 3 trials, which are large-scale studies to confirm the results and gather more data.
